I've got about 50 rounds off in my new P365. I've got small hands but I still have to interlock pinkies to get a left hand grip that's firm enough for my tastes. The trigger is 5lbs 10oz using my Wheeler gauge. I had to find my UpLULA mag loader for these 10 rounders because I can only push in 7 and it takes some effort to get that done. These mag springs are tough.
